Description
Sangermani Classic Yawl
Rondine II was built in 1948 by Cesare Sangermani, Lavagna, the famous Italian classic yacht builder. She is a Mahogany and Teak yawl. She offers eight berths in three cabins, has two heads and has two crew berths. Mechanical propulsion is by Ford 80 hp diesel.
In 2006 she was fully restored. Rondine II has been in the limelight in the most famous classic yacht regattas in the Mediterranean, Porto Cervo, Imperia, Saint Tropez, Palma de Mallorca etc., for many years.
